About Rémi

I do this work primarily to share things that I am passionate about. Isn't it fascinating to dive into another period? For example the one where Europeans broaden their vision of the world and meet (by chance) civilizations with which they have never shared anything? To discover Mexico-Tenochtitlan (the Aztec capital) in the 16th century is to travel to another world, where gold lines the streets, ritual human sacrifices take place, unknown plants are cultivated (tobacco, coffee, potato , tomatoes), an incredible system of thought exists... but not writing! Nor the wheel! In short, immersing yourself in history means broadening your thinking, answering many questions about the world around us; in short, it is to enrich oneself culturally.
And geography in all this? Geography is not learning rivers and capitals by heart, just like history is not learning dates. Of course, you have to master the basics. But we can't stop at that. Geography is to decipher space, to understand the organization of the world. Why when a boat blocks the Suez Canal for 6 days, nearly 10 billion euros are lost? Why is the war in Ukraine leaving the oil shelves empty? Because the world is interconnected, global trade routes pass through strategic spaces that are vulnerable (congestion, ecology, piracy, etc.). To understand this you have to study things at different scales, this is the geographic method par excellence.

My experience shows me that you learn best when you set realistic goals, in order to progress step by step. It's all about adapting to your audience.
I usually start with an exchange with the student on the state of knowledge in order to identify what is known/understood and what needs to be reworked, before going any further. Work on the documents is also essential (it is part of all exams and competitive exams).
State teacher (CAPES, a french competitive exam) in history and geography, I teach here in video, to students from middle school to college.
